Celtic League Quarter Finals

Munster will have home advantage when they take on Connacht in the Celtic League quarter-final while Ulster must travel to Glasgow.

Munster finished top of Pool A following their 41-0 victory over Caerphilly in Thomond Park on Friday night.
ConnachtCardiff lost at home to Pontypridd they picked up a bonus point which left them on the same points (20) as Connacht but with a superior points scored record.

Cardiff will travel to Edinburgh while Pontypridd will take on fellow Welsh side Neath at Sardis Road.

Celtic League Quarter Finals. (Weekend Nov. 30th).
1. Munster v Connacht.
2. Pontypridd v Neath.
3. Glasgow v Ulster.
4. Edinburgh v Cardiff.

Celtic League Semi-Final.
Munster or Connacht v Glasgow or Ulster.
Pontypridd or Neath v Edinburgh or Cardiff.
